On Tue, Jul 17, 2007 at 11:54:00PM +0100, Paul Tansom wrote:
[...]
> t the bottom I have several sections with folder-hook conditions loading
> in configuration from separte files, so:
>
> folder-hook .*.Ilinuxlore    source ~/.mutt/ac.linuxlore


[...]

> Sadly sometimes the From and record settings are not always picked up
> and remain set to those chosen for the last folder I was reading, or
> earlier. The signature usually, but not 100% of the time, is correct.
>
> Anyone any ideas?


You will also need folder hooks or whatever matching "anything" (.)
in order to reset the values back to your defaults, as otherwise
they will never get reset and the values will remain as whatever the
last hook that fired set them to.
